Abstract
The utility model discloses a kind of two-temperature freezer with constant refrigeration room, comprise the condenser, refrigeration evaporator, refrigerating evaporator and the compressor that are in turn connected into loop, compressor is controlled by freezing temperature controller, also comprises and is arranged on the refrigeration heater in the refrigerating chamber of two-temperature freezer and the magnetic-sensing temperature switch for controlling to refrigerate heater work.The utility model, by increasing the refrigeration heater for heating refrigerating chamber and the magnetic-sensing temperature switch for controlling to refrigerate heater work, not only structural design is relatively simple to make two-temperature freezer, and can the temperature of automatic control and adjustment refrigerating chamber flexibly, and make it under different environments for use, remain on best refrigerated storage temperature.

Background technology
The temperature control method of two-temperature freezer is in the market generally with under type: namely by making refrigerating chamber also ensue variations in temperature to the control of freezer temperature.But when reality uses, the difference of gear set by the difference of environment for use temperature and refrigerating chamber temperature controller, the variations in temperature of refrigerating chamber is larger.Through actual measurement, the temperature of refrigerating chamber can change between 13 DEG C ~-5 DEG C, and the cold storing and fresh-keeping effect of refrigerating chamber will be made so greatly to reduce.
Utility model content
Technical problem to be solved in the utility model is the temperature controller adjustment temperature that refrigerating chamber followed by existing two-temperature freezer refrigerating chamber, thus reduces the problem of cold storing and fresh-keeping effect.
In order to solve the problems of the technologies described above, the technical scheme that the utility model adopts is to provide a kind of two-temperature freezer with constant refrigeration room, comprise the condenser, refrigeration evaporator, refrigerating evaporator and the compressor that are in turn connected into loop, described compressor is controlled by freezing temperature controller, also comprises the refrigeration heater in the refrigerating chamber being arranged on described two-temperature freezer and the magnetic-sensing temperature switch for controlling the work of described refrigeration heater.
In such scheme, described refrigeration heater and described magnetic-sensing temperature switch form series circuit, and described series circuit is connected to the two poles of the earth of the power supply of described two-temperature freezer.
In such scheme, also comprise touching switch, it is arranged on the door of described two-temperature freezer, and described touching switch is used for controlling described refrigeration heater when described two-temperature freezer opens the door and stops heating.
The utility model, by increasing the refrigeration heater for heating refrigerating chamber and the magnetic-sensing temperature switch for controlling to refrigerate heater work, not only structural design is relatively simple to make two-temperature freezer, and can the temperature of automatic control and adjustment refrigerating chamber neatly, and make it under different environments for use, remain on best refrigerated storage temperature.

Detailed description of the invention
Below in conjunction with Figure of description, the utility model is described in detail.
As shown in Figure 1, the two-temperature freezer of what the utility model provided have constant refrigeration room comprises condenser 4, refrigeration evaporator 5, refrigerating evaporator 6, compressor 7 and controls the freezing temperature controller 1 of compressor 7, also comprise and be arranged on the refrigeration heater 3 in the refrigerating chamber of two-temperature freezer and the magnetic-sensing temperature switch 2 for controlling to refrigerate heater 3 work, the input port of condenser 4 is connected to the blast pipe of compressor 7, and the delivery outlet of condenser 4 is connected to the inflow port of refrigeration evaporator 5; The outflow port of refrigeration evaporator 5 is connected to the inflow port of refrigerating evaporator 6, and the outflow port of refrigerating evaporator 6 is connected to the air intake duct of compressor 7, realizes refrigeration evaporator 5 and refrigerating evaporator 6 shares; Refrigeration heater 3 forms series circuit with temperature sensitive switch 2, series circuit is connected to the two poles of the earth of the power supply of two-temperature freezer, the lead-out wire of two contacts of freezing temperature controller 1 is connected to the two poles of the earth of power supply, and for controlling compressor 7 start-stop, magnetic-sensing temperature switch 2 controls the temperature of refrigerating chamber.
During use first under room temperature environment, connected by freezing temperature controller 1, freezer temperature reduces, and temperature of refrigerating chamber is along with reduction, and when temperature of refrigerating chamber is lower than 2 DEG C, magnetic-sensing temperature switch 2 is connected automatically, and refrigeration heater 3 works, and heats to refrigerating chamber; When temperature of refrigerating chamber is increased to about 5 DEG C, magnetic-sensing temperature switch 2 disconnects, and stops heating, thus make cold store temperature remain on change between 3 DEG C ~ 6 DEG C, therefore no matter refrigerator opening time how long, temperature of refrigerating chamber all can be constant in 3-6 DEG C, and can not by the impact of freezer temperature change.Magnetic-sensing temperature switch in present embodiment 2 and refrigeration heater 3 all can with prior art with the use of.
The utility model also comprises touching switch, and it is arranged on the door of two-temperature freezer, and touching switch is used for the Synchronization Control refrigeration heater 3 when two-temperature freezer opens the door and stops heating, and when avoiding further opening the door, temperature raises too fast, and touching switch adopts prior art.
The utility model, structure is simple, with low cost, control reliable, by increasing the refrigeration heater 3 for heating refrigerating chamber and the magnetic-sensing temperature switch 2 for controlling to refrigerate heater 3 work, not only structural design is relatively simple to make two-temperature freezer, and can the temperature of automatic control and adjustment refrigerating chamber flexibly, and makes it under different environments for use, remain on best refrigerated storage temperature.
